What is genetics?
Genetics is a discipline of biology that studies genes, genetic diversity, and heritability in animals.
Though heredity had been observed for millennia, Gregor Mendel, a Moravian scientist and Augustinian priest working in Brno in the nineteenth century, was the first to do scientific research on genetics.
Mendel researched "trait inheritance," or the patterns in how characteristics are passed down from parents to children through time.
He discovered that organisms (pea plants) pass on features through separate "units of inheritance." This word, which is still in use today, is a slightly unclear description of what is known as a gene.
In the twenty-first century, trait inheritance and molecular inheritance processes of genes remain essential concepts of genetics, but modern genetics has moved beyond inheritance to explore the function and activity of genes.

in how many ways can a committee of 20 members choose a president, a vice-president, and a secretary?
There are 6840 ways to choose a president, a vice-president, and a secretary from a committee of 20 members.
To choose a president, a vice-president, and a secretary from a committee of 20 members,
We will use the formula for combinations,
which is: C(n, k) = n! / (k! (n - k)!)
where n is the total number of members and k is the number of members being chosen.
So, for n = 20 and k = 1, we have:
C(20, 1) = 20! / (1! (20 - 1)!) = 20
This gives us 20 choices for the president.
For the vice president,
We need to choose 1 member from the remaining 19 members.
So, for n = 19 and k = 1,
we have:
C(19, 1) = 19! / (1! (19 - 1)!) = 19
This gives us 19 choices for the vice president.
Finally, for the secretary,
We need to choose 1 member from the remaining 18 members.
So, for n = 18 and k = 1,
we have:
C(18, 1) = 18! / (1! (18 - 1)!) = 18
This gives us 18 choices for the secretary.
Now for finding the total number of ways to choose the three positions, we multiply the number of choices for each position:
So, the required number of ways will be 20 * 19 * 18 = 6840
